• Viernes 3 de Mayo de 2024, 05:07

Mostrar Mensajes

Esta sección te permite ver todos los posts escritos por este usuario. Ten en cuenta que sólo puedes ver los posts escritos en zonas a las que tienes acceso en este momento.


Mensajes - fachamix

Páginas: 1 ... 7 8 [9]
201
C/C++ / Re: Problema Con Djgpp
« en: Martes 27 de Mayo de 2008, 02:44 »
decinos cual era el problema entonces!!!!!!!!!!

202
C/C++ / Re: C Ficheros Lectura Escritura
« en: Martes 27 de Mayo de 2008, 02:40 »
No soy el mejor programador de C, pero no creo haber visto esto antes en un programa:

void main (fichero *entrada, fichero2 *salida)

mi pregunta seria, ¿como haces para invocar a un programa con parametros de este tipo??

creo que deberias copiarnos bien los resultados de tu compilador.

no se entiende nada

203
C/C++ / Re: Como Instalar Las Sdl En Code::blocks Para Xp
« en: Martes 27 de Mayo de 2008, 02:32 »
que son las SDL ????

204
C++ Builder / Bd (mysql) Y C++builder
« en: Jueves 22 de Mayo de 2008, 22:11 »
Gente necesito ayuda.

Uso C++Builder 6.

Lo que quiero es interactuar, hacer un programa que utilize MySQL.

No tengo idea como arrancar.

Ya lei la documentacion que trae borland, pero es algo avanzada para mi.

Ya trabaje con ADO en visual basic (por si les ayuda a ayudarme).

Gracias che.

205
C++ Builder / Re: Archivos De Texto En Builder.
« en: Jueves 22 de Mayo de 2008, 22:05 »
claro, mira te explico de otra manera.

en BINARIO: la informacion se "guarda" de manera codificada, pero cuando vos la recuperas, es totalemente legible. Entonces, si vas a almacenar informacion que luego va  aser leida ATRAVEZ de tu programa, esta es la meor opcion.

Por ej: Muestras la informacion del archivo en un STring Grid, entonces usa los archivos binarios.


en TEXTO, la informacion se guarda, TAL CUAL LA ENVIAS A GUARDAR, esto quiere decir que si mandas a guardar la cadena "HOLA FACHAMIX" al archivo probando.dat, cuando abraz el archivo probando.dat con un editor de texto cualquiera, veras y podras leer la cadena "HOLA FACHAMIX".

Este tipo de archivos es muy util cuando guardas informacion con un FORMATO ESPECIFICO , por ejemplo, si quieres generar un informe en formato HTML, usa un archivo de texto para ir guardando el codigo HTML que generas.+


EN RESUMEN:

AL GUARDAR datos en archivos binarios, el com`pilador "CODIFICA" la informacion a guardar en el archivo para el rapido acceso a la misma despues.
EN CAMBIO al guardar datos en un archivo de TEXTO, el compilador no codifica nada y la guarda comoviene jajajaja

206
C++ Builder / Re: Archivos De Texto En Builder.
« en: Jueves 22 de Mayo de 2008, 02:33 »
mira, te recomiendo que guardes los datos, no en archivos de texto, sino en archivos BINARIOS.

ese es mi consejo, pues el acceso a los mismos es mucho mas rapidos.

Para aclarar:

La principal y mas delatora diferencia entre archivos de texto y binarios, es que los de texto guardan el contenido deseado de forma plana en el archivo, es decir, si guardas la cadena "HOLA", y abres el archivo, veras la cadena HOLA, y sera legible por el usuario. Si guardas "HOLA" en un archivo binario, y abres el archivo veras un conjunto de caracteres ilegibles por el humano (algunos jajajaja) pero si son entendidos por tu programa.

Los archivos BINARIOS te daran tambien, la ventaja de guardar y recuperar el contenido de tu archivo en forma de registros, utilizando ESTRUCTURAS (struct)

es decir, podras escribir estructuras, y leer estructuras.

hay mucho info al respecto.

Busca en los lirbos de C, te recomiendo el de referencia de C por McGrawHill

207
C++ Builder / Re: No Admite Stl String
« en: Miércoles 21 de Mayo de 2008, 02:38 »
Che perdon por meterme, pero por lo poco que entiendo de los post , creo que su discucion pasaba por el software propietario y el libre ?????.


Si es asi , estan discutiendo cualquier cosa, todo tiene su pro y su contra, y las 2 partes lo saben.

Es mas recomiendo que habran otro tema , en el foro , y que cada usuario del foro brinde sus argumentos en pro o contra de los tipos de soft  que ya e mencionado.

y ahi vamos a tener un debate un poco mas sano .


salute !!!!

208
Diseño de Algoritmos / Re: Algoritmo De Huffman
« en: Miércoles 21 de Mayo de 2008, 02:29 »
mira, te lo resumo ...... GOOGLE, aprende a usar GOOGLE antes que cualquier cosa.

escribi:

Hoffman source code


y si lo quieres mas especifico , escribi:

VB Hoffman source code


o

Hoffman codigo fuente

209
C/C++ / Re: Compiladores
« en: Miércoles 21 de Mayo de 2008, 02:27 »
mira , antes que nada, tienes que entender algo, que linux tiene una gran desventaja, y es su gran variedad de opcion de configuracion.

vos tienes que pensar que tu entorno visual va a responder al entorno visual que uses (KDE, GNOME, etc).

entonces tienes que partir desde el vamos, y el vamos seria que entorno visual tienes vos.

cuando ya elijas tu entorno recien puedes elegir entre las opciones que puedas encontarr.

yo no programo en linux (por ahora), pero tuve la oportunidad de ver a KDevelop en accion , y me parecio increible.

te recoiendo KDevelop antes que ningun otro IDE.

210
C++ Builder / Re: No Admite Stl String
« en: Martes 20 de Mayo de 2008, 03:25 »
JAJAJAJAJAJAJJA gracias muchachos.


hice eso, use AnsiString y palo y a la bolsa (por ahora)

saludos mcuhachos, gracias

211
C++ Builder / No Admite Stl String
« en: Sábado 17 de Mayo de 2008, 20:32 »
Buenas muchachos.

Compilador: C++Builder 6.

Problema:

Creo un proyecto, File, New, Appplication (no se si es asi realemnte pero ustedes me entienden)

Bien se crea el formulario, todo muy lindo.

Ahora. Yo estoy haciendo un programa que va a interactuar con archivos creados por el mismo programa, para su lectura y escritura.

Y quiero crear un .H con una clase y una serie de funciones, para que la manipulacion de esas archivos sea mas facil.

entonces hago lo siguiente:

File, New , Unit

y se crea mu .H :
//---------------------------------------------------------------------------


#pragma hdrstop

#include "Unit2.h"

//---------------------------------------------------------------------------

#pragma package(smart_init)





Ahora agrego STL string:

//---------------------------------------------------------------------------


#pragma hdrstop
#include <string>
#include "Unit2.h"

//---------------------------------------------------------------------------

#pragma package(smart_init)


Hasta aqui sin problemas de compilacon , pero cuando creao una variable string:

//---------------------------------------------------------------------------


#pragma hdrstop
#include <string>
#include "Unit2.h"

class ClasePrueba {
    public:
        string cadena;
};
//---------------------------------------------------------------------------

#pragma package(smart_init)

Y quiero compilar tengo los siquientes errores en la linea "string cadena;"

[C++ Error] Unit2.cpp(10): E2303 Type name expected
[C++ Error] Unit2.cpp(10): E2139 Declaration missing ;


que estoy haciendo mal???


Para terminar, creo un programa para C++ usando el Console Wizard, y si me deja usar STL string, pero para aplicaciones con formulario no .


Un mano muchachos

212
C++ Builder / Re: Declaracion De Variable
« en: Sábado 17 de Mayo de 2008, 20:21 »
apuesto lo que sea a que no estaba incluyendo (#include) el .H donde la queria usar

213
C/C++ / Re: Pido Humildemente Orientación C/c++,
« en: Sábado 17 de Mayo de 2008, 20:00 »
OJO!!!!

Mira, cualquier compilador de C/C++ que utilizes te va a servir, pero ...


Parahacer lo que vos quieres, tienes que usar las APis de windows (si tu PC tiene este OS) o las del OS que use tu PC.

Existe un libro en formato digital que lo peudes bajar por emule, ares, etc:

.Manejo de Puertos en Win32 - MScomm.pdf

o

.Programming the Parallel Port - book.pdf


buscalos, te vana  aayudar, pero eso si, tienes que manejar bien C o C++ para poder usarlos, algo que no es del todo facil ya que al ser lenguajes flexibles tienen un grado de abstraccion.

por ejemplo: en C , no existe el tipo de datos String como en basic, pero si se lo puede emular mediante almacenamiento de memoria dinamica.

214
Papelera / Re: Problemas En C++
« en: Sábado 17 de Mayo de 2008, 19:51 »
te quiero ayudar, pero no me voy a poner a analisar el codigo, si no me dices que error/es te tira el compilador

215
C/C++ / S.o Real Mode 16 Bits
« en: Viernes 27 de Octubre de 2006, 03:02 »
queria empesar a ahcer un sistema operativo en modo real (16 bits) y estaba usando DJGPP pero lei que gerena codigo de 32bits que no me ivan a servir.

entonce smi pregunta es la siguiente............


como tendria que ser mi entorno de trabajo para desarrollarlo ????? me refiero a que compialdor de C y ASM usar etc.


garcias por la ayuda .

el que quier aprenderse, bienvenido sera.

216
C/C++ / Re: C & Assembly - Parametros
« en: Viernes 27 de Octubre de 2006, 02:58 »
gracias hermano, me sirvio mucho ya se donde estaban los parametrios.

respondanme esta otra pregunta (otro topico)

217
C/C++ / Re: C & Assembly - Parametros
« en: Jueves 26 de Octubre de 2006, 03:05 »
uso DJGPP (gcc de windows) y NASM

218
C/C++ / C & Assembly - Parametros
« en: Jueves 26 de Octubre de 2006, 03:02 »
quiero utilizar las funciones del BIOS, lo ke mas me intereza es trabajar con las funciones graficas, como poner a la pantalla en 320 x 200, y dibujar un pixel en pantalla para despues progresar.


mi pregunta es la siguiente.........................

desde un programa en C, como hago para llamar a una funcion en assembler y pasarle parametros ?????? la funcion en assembler esta en otro archivo . ej:

------------------------------ MAIN.C --------------------
void bios_line(int x, int y, int x2, int y2);
....
....
/*en algun momento del codigo llamar a esa funcion que esta en un archivo ensamblador */
bios_line(0,0,100,100);

/* COMO MANDO EL 0 , 0 , 100 , 100. COMO MANDO ESOS PARAMETROS!!!!!!!!!!!!! */
...
...
...
----------------------------------------------------------------

el problema que tengo no se trata de saber mezclar C con ASSEMBLY, sino que no se como enviar parametros desde C a ASSEMBLY

Páginas: 1 ... 7 8 [9]